Homemade Granola

Contributed by: Bob's Red Mill Natural Foods

Homemade Granola

Directions

Step 1

Preheat oven to 350°F.

Combine all dry ingredients together into a large bowl.

Step 2

Heat honey, oil, and water until well blended.

Add liquid to dry ingredients and mix well until all dry ingredients are moistened.

Step 3

Place on a cookie sheet and bake at 350°F for about 45 minutes. Stir every 15 minutes so mixture will be evenly toasted.

Makes about 30 servings.

Notes

You may like to add raisins when used as a breakfast cereal or when added to a recipe.
